Infineon Technologies TLE4973 EVAL LAT BAR Board

Infineon Technologies TLE4973 EVAL LAT BAR Board is a current sensor evaluation board designed for the evaluation of three-phase systems, with up to 682A current. This evaluation board is equipped with three TLE4973-RE35S5-S0010 Hall current sensors assembled on top of the PCB. The TLE4973 EVAL LAT BAR board consists of three external copper bus bars routing the tree phases externally over each sensor. This board comes assembled with copper bus bars and auxiliary mechanical elements for attaching high-current cables or busbars. The TLE4973 EVAL LAT BAR board can be used as a standalone or interconnected with the Infineon CUR SENSOR PROG GEN2 tool. This board is AEC-Q100 automotive qualified. The TLE4973 EVAL LAT BAR board is ideal for applications such as automotive Battery Management System (BMS), battery pack monitoring, medium voltage drives, central inverter solutions, and traction inverters.

Features

  • External current rail sensors
  • Ideal for evaluating systems with up to 682A currents
  • Based on the TLE4973-RE35S5-S0010 sensor
  • Onboard 5V LDO for sensor supply
  • Programmable sensor settings
  • Use with CUR SENSOR PROG GEN2
  • PCB calibration report is offered
  • AEC-Q100 automotive qualified

Applications

  • Traction inverters
  • Auxiliary inverters
  • Automotive Battery Management System (BMS)
  • Battery pack monitoring
  • Battery disconnection
  • Solid state circuit breakers
  • Medium voltage drives
  • Central inverter solutions
